A stable genetic transformation method using rubber grass callus as explant
By using the genetic transformation method of rubber grass callus tissue, the problem of low transformation efficiency of rubber grass has been solved, and homozygous transgenic plants have been obtained efficiently with high positive detection rate, fast growth rate and high propagation efficiency, which is suitable for the optimization of rubber grass genetic transformation system.

AI Technical Summary
Existing methods for genetic transformation of rubber grass are inefficient, making it difficult to obtain homozygous transgenic materials. Furthermore, self-incompatibility in rubber grass leads to severe strain mixing, resulting in low transformation efficiency and making it difficult to meet the demand for large quantities of transgenic rubber grass materials.
Rubber grass callus was used as explants. Through antibiotic screening and optimization of culture medium composition, including steps such as callus induction, proliferation, infection, co-culture, screening and rooting culture, the transformation efficiency and homozygosity were improved. Homozygous positive cell lines were obtained by Agrobacterium infection and antibiotic screening.
It has achieved efficient acquisition of a large number of transgenic plants with high conversion rate, low malformation rate, positive detection rate of over 95%, short genetic transformation cycle, and strong embryogenicity and proliferation ability of rubber grass callus tissue, which can rapidly propagate a large number of positive seedlings.
